スタディスト開発ブログ Advent Calendar 2021の20日目の記事です。本日は技術支援ユニットの笹木(@s_sasaki_0529) が、開発環境で Rails を立ち上げずに、リモートAPIサーバに接続してフロントエンド開発を行えるようにした話をします。 TL;DRSPA なのに Rails と Vue が密になってるアプリケーションを開発してるせめて開発環境ぐらいはフロントエンド単体で開発できる状態にしたい様々な問題を対処し、理想のフロントエンド開発環境を実現したTeachme Biz の現状のアーキテクチャスタディストが開発・運用する、マニュアル作成・共有システム Teachme Biz は、Vue.js (≠ Nuxt.js) によるフロントエンドと、Ruby on Rails によるバックエンドで構成されています。 Teachme Biz (Web) の大雑把な構成